I've heard that Humboldt line more than a few times on these boards. That's wonderful if you live in Humboldt. In that case just stick to the method that works for you. Those of us with more significant limitations are looking for other solutions. I don't live in Humboldt so the pound growing in the forest isn't an option. I don't like the idea of a HID burning in my basement with my family asleep above or me away from the house. No thanks. I also have venting limitations that would present real problems running an HID. I'm not growing pounds for whatever use you put that to. I just need a few ounces per grow for personal use. If yield is off by a few grams do I care? No. If it takes a week or two longer do I care? No. Does it provide for me needs - that I care about.
